HISTORY OF THE BENDER

Bender is one of the main characters of Futurama. It was made in Mexico in 2997 with the serial number 2716057. Bender is a comic anti-hero, foul-mouthed, alcoholic, cigar smoker, kleptomaniac. He is cook however his food is life-threatening. He drinks a lot of alcohol to recharge his fuel cells. When he burps, out of his mouth comes out a fire like a small mechanical dragon. Small because its height is only 168. However, it is made of a very durable alloy that gives it the ability to survive after more than one explosion. In a critical situation, he always panics. Usually, Bender behaves like a complete egoist, but occasionally it awakens sympathy and friendly affection for Fry. Since Fry is his friend and the one who saved him from suicide.

ABOUT THIS 3D PRINTING MINIATURE

Bender 3D miniature for printing was created in ZBrush. The model is saved in STL files, a format supported by most 3D printers

FDM version features:
- Contain 31 parts;
- Made with connectors and locks;
- You can choose between the connectors 25_B_claw (x4) and 25v2_B_claw (x4) depending on the flexibility of your printing material;
- Made with the New Year's cap and with two girlfriends which you can remove;
- Has a version with cigar and cigarette lighter;
- Has an opening door of the squeezer with bottle inside;
- Special hand for holding bottle;
- All parts are divided in such way that you will print them with the smallest amount of supports.

SLS/SLA version features:

- Same as FDM but smaller and made as 7 part in different variants.

All .STL files for 3D printing have been checked in Netfabb and no errors were shown.

Note: Before starting 3D printing the model, read the Printing Details for CURA 3.1.0. Software.

There are 31 parts for FFF/FDM version and 7 part for SLS/SLA version.


All parts of connectors should be printed at 100% infill.

Scale: His tall in life is 1800 mm. Model made as 1/8 scale in FDM version and 1/16 in SLS/SLA version.

FDM version dimensions:

After being printed will stand - 232 mm tall, 148 mm wide, 83 mm deep;

- Connectors should be printed at 100% infill to make them solid.

SLS/SLA version dimensions:

After being printed will stand - 116 mm tall, 74 mm wide, 41.5 mm deep;

- Has only 1 detail in each variant, to keep printing costs down.
